Explore Costco's Enchanting 'Narnia' Murphy Bed for Your Home

Cozy Costco Murphy Bed in Rustic Room with Fireplace

The Magic of Multi-Functional Spaces

As homeowners today seek to maximize their living spaces without the need for extensive renovations, multi-functional furniture like Murphy beds is enjoying a renaissance. These versatile pieces add considerable value to any home, making them a practical choice for those looking to optimize their space, especially in urban living situations where every square foot counts. The latest offering from Costco, the "Narnia" cabinet bed, is an excellent example of how design can meet function in an aesthetic package.

Why Choose a Murphy Bed?

Costco's Illusion Queen Cabinet Bed not only serves as a stylish storage solution but also comes equipped with a comfortable hypoallergenic foam mattress and an innovative design that includes a built-in charging station. This makes it a contemporary choice for various room settings—be it a guest room, living area, or even an office space that needs a quick transformation into a cozy guest haven.

A Closer Look at the Narnia Inspiration

The whimsical concept behind the "Narnia" Murphy bed draws inspiration from classic literature, particularly the magical wardrobe from C.S. Lewis's beloved series. Picture a sleek cabinet that, when opened, reveals your sleeping space. This creative design marvel plays on the idea of hidden space and encourages users to embrace the duality of functionality and whimsy in their interiors.

Additional Tips for Choosing the Right Murphy Bed

When selecting the perfect Murphy bed for your home, consider the following:

  • Space Requirements: Measure your space thoroughly to ensure the bed fits comfortably without overcrowding the room.
  • Design Aesthetics: Choose a style that complements your existing decor, whether it’s modern, farmhouse, or traditional.
  • Quality and Materials: Opt for beds constructed from durable materials that prove to be both reliable and long-lasting.

Costco’s Competitive Edge

With its reputation for quality and affordability, Costco continues to stand out in the furniture market. Their commitment to providing functional and stylish solutions extends beyond just Murphy beds; it influences a variety of home solutions that blend practicality with appealing design. Shoppers can also enjoy additional benefits, such as free shipping, which further sweetens the deal.

Uncovering Ailsa Craig: The Hidden Island of Curling Stones

Update Discovering Ailsa Craig: The Home of Curling Stones Your next favorite curling stone has a more surprising origin story than you might think. Nestled in the Firth of Clyde off the west coast of Scotland lies Ailsa Craig, an uninhabited island that has played a vital role in the world of curling for over two centuries. It’s not just a unique geographic landmark; this volcanic island is the source of the finest granite used to craft curling stones, making it essential for the sport's elite competitors. The Geological Gem of Ailsa Craig Ailsa Craig rises dramatically from the sea, a notable sight long admired by sailors navigating between Belfast and Glasgow. Its rugged geology features rare micro-granites formed through ancient volcanic activity. The two unique types—Blue Hone and Common Green— are crucial not just for aesthetics but for their ideal properties in crafting curling stones. The granite has specific characteristics that make it perfect for the demands of curling. Blue Hone provides an exceptionally fine-grained outer band, prized for its durability in harsh ice conditions. As enthusiasts and competitors alike gather every four years for the Winter Olympics, it becomes clear just how significant Ailsa Craig is to this beloved winter sport. The Journey from Quarry to Competition Extracted in controlled bursts, granite blocks are meticulously processed in Mauchline, Scotland. This small town is home to Kays Curling, the world's leading manufacturer of curling stones. The process of transforming raw granite into perfect curling stones is labor-intensive, taking hours of cutting, shaping, and polishing. Each stone undergoes rigorous machining, and craftsmen work diligently to ensure that surfaces are polished to precise tolerances. It results in stones that are consistent in behavior, whether they are thrown in Stockholm or Saskatchewan, which is essential for high-stakes competition. On average, about 2,000 to 3,000 stones are produced annually, priced roughly at $960 each, making curling a luxury sport for many. But the investment is justified—every stone is a piece of art shaped by natural forces and human skill. Discover Ailsa Craig: The Heart of Stone Curling Treasures

Update Ailsa Craig: The Home of Curling Stones Located off the west coast of Scotland, Ailsa Craig is a volcanic island with a fascinating history, primarily known for its unique granite production used in curling stones. The island, often referred to as "Paddy's Milestone," has been a part of Scotland's legacy for over two centuries, shaping the equipment of this peculiar yet thrilling sport. The Geological Wonders Behind Curling Stones What makes Ailsa Craig indispensable to curling? It’s all in the geology. The island’s granite, consisting of two specific types, Blue Hone and Ailsa Craig Common Green, are renowned for their durability and low water absorption. This durability is crucial for stones that must endure the freezing temperatures of ice rinks and the impact of play. The Blue Hone, a fine-grained stone, is particularly valued for its resistance to water penetration—an essential quality that prevents cracking over time. The Art of Craftsmanship: From Quarry to Curling After extraction, Ailsa's granite undergoes a meticulous crafting process in Mauchline, Ayrshire, where Kays Curling, the world’s leading manufacturer, processes the stone. Each curling stone is not merely molded but shaped with precision, taking hours to machine and polish. Craftspeople ensure that every handle is perfectly attached, and every surface meets exacting standards. It is a labor-intensive process where quality matters as much as quantity, producing about 2,000 to 3,000 stones annually. Unique Value of Ailsa Craig for Enthusiasts For homeowners and business owners investing in a curling stone, it’s essential to recognize the uniqueness of Ailsa Craig. Each stone, priced around $960, represents not only significant craftsmanship but also a connection to a centuries-old tradition. The uniformity of the stones ensures that no matter where you play—be it Stockholm or Saskatchewan—they will perform consistently, a testament to the quality that Ailsa Craig granite embodies. Discover How Casita Chica Reflects Personal Style and Vibrancy

Update The Splendor of Casita Chica: A Vibrant Family Legacy Nestled in San Antonio's historic Monte Vista neighborhood, the transformation of Casita Chica, a 1929 cottage renovated by designer Galeana Younger, celebrates not just exquisite design but also a heartfelt family legacy. The decision to convert the home to a spacious one-bedroom was driven by a unique vision—to create a sanctuary for her 77-year-old mother, Chica Younger. This personal touch makes the design even more meaningful: it reflects not just a home, but a vibrant life lived fully and without hesitation. A Personal Touch: Design for Life Emphasizing the quote from her mother, "I won't have to worry about resale. I'll be dead," Younger captures both sentiment and pragmatism. Each design choice made was less about market trends and much more about ensuring her mother lives her best life, indulging in bold colors and rich textures that mirror Mexican heritage. Galeana Younger has effectively crafted a space that exudes warmth, energy, and joy, inviting family and friends to foster connections beyond mere decoration. Custom Touches: Built-Ins and Found Treasures The heart of the renovation lies in its custom millwork, providing space for Younger’s mom's cherished artworks and unique collections. Younger's belief in the power of built-ins translates into a beautifully functional home that blends generations together. From a vibrant living room to an eye-catching kitchen with zesty lemon-yellow cabinetry, it all ties into a seamless narrative of comfort, creativity, and charm. Community and Family: Creating Meaningful Spaces The home is also designed for socialization. The converted breakfast room transformed into a bar invites conversation and laughter, fostering a space for family gatherings. Whether hosting a Sunday dinner or intimate cocktail parties, the design encourages connections that go beyond decorative aesthetics and echo the very essence of family. Design Elements That Stand Out One notable feature is the entryway, where celadon wallpaper—carried by Chica for decades—offers a vibrant welcome. This corner not only showcases the homeowner's aesthetic journey but also serves as a conversation starter, an art piece of its own. Similarly, the carefully sourced vintage pieces throughout symbolize family heritage and the warmth of home, elevating ordinary spaces into extraordinary settings. The Role of Color in Creating Inviting Environments Bright hues, rich patterns, and layered textures unify the home, reminding us of the essential role color plays in our lived experiences. Galeana emphasizes that color combinations can maintain femininity without being overly delicate, creating environments that are both comfortable and inviting. The overall design encourages an exploration of styles that resonate personally rather than adhering strictly to trends.
